LENGUAJES DE PROGRAMACIÓN

EVOLUCIÓN DE LOS LENGUAJES DE PROGRAMACIÓN

Primer compilador

La matemática estadounidense Grace Murray Hopper
desarrolla el primer compilador, un programa que
traduce las instrucciones con palabras en inglés
al lenguaje máquina de una computadora.

descarga (14)

En los años 1950 ocurre la Creación del Lenguaje Ensamblador

Mauricio V. Vilkes inventa el lenguaje ensamblador.
Anteriormente la programación se efectuaba directamente
en binario. Cada modelo de ordenador tenía su propio código
lo que dificultaba su manejo.

ensamblador

Luego en 1957 se desarrolló el Lenguaje Fortran

Jhon Backus de IBM inventa Fortran, el primer lenguaje
de programación universal considerado de alto nivel,
de propósito general e imperativo. Fortran es un lenguaje
especialmente adecuado para el cálculo numérico y computación
científica, también abarca un linaje de versiones, cada una de
las cuales evolucionaron para añadir extensiones a la lengua
mientras que normalmente retiene la compatibilidad con versiones
anteriores.

images

1958 Creación del lenguaje Lisp

Después de Fortran fue el segundo lenguaje de
programación de alto nivel. Creado por Jhon McCarthy
en el MIT. El elemento fundamental de Lisp es la lista,
pues tanto un dato o una función se expresa como una lista.
Fue desarrollado inicialmente sobre un IBM 7090.
Se convirtió rápidamente en el lenguaje de programación favorito
en la investigación de la inteligencia artificial (AI). Como uno
de los primeros lenguajes de programación, Lisp fue pionero en muchas
ideas en ciencias de la computación, incluyendo las estructuras de datos
de árbol, el manejo de almacenamiento automático, tipos dinámicos, y el
compilador auto contenido.

images (1)

1959 Se inventa Cobol

Lenguaje de programación que se inventó con el
objetivo de crear un lenguaje de programación
universal que pudiera ser usado en cualquier
ordenador, ya que en los años 1960 existían numerosos
modelos de ordenadores incompatibles entre sí, y que
estuviera orientado principalmente a los negocios.
Se caracterizó por tener una excelente capacidad
de auto documentación, buena gestión de archivos y de
datos de la época.

images (2)

1964 Se inventa el Lenguaje Basic
Lenguaje de programación desarrollado por
Jhon Kemeny y Thomas Kurts en Estados Unidos.
Inicialmente se desarrolló para facilitar a los
estudiantes a programar computadoras. Su uso era
para propósito general, aunque un tanto lento y simple.

1970 Creación de Pascal

Pascal es un lenguaje de programación de
alto nivel creado por Nicklaus Wirth.
Se convirtió en uno de los lenguajes más
utilizados en cursos de introducción a la
programación. Se desarrolló para hacer posible
la programación estructurada y también soporta
la programación orientada a objetos.

descarga

1972 Lenguaje de Programación C

Dennis Ritchie de los Laboratorios Bell
reanuda el lenguaje B escrito por Ken Thompson
y lo convierte en un verdadero compilador que
genera el código máquina (B era un intérprete).
C es utilizado por la eficiencia de su código para
generar aplicaciones y software de sistemas.

descarga (1)

1990 Java

Lenguaje de programación desarrollado por Sun
Microsystems. Se desarrolló de tal forma que
los programas desarrollados con Java puedan
ejecutarse de la misma manera en diferentes arquitecturas.
Java permite escribir programas de gráficos o textuales.
También es uno de los lenguajes de programación más
populares en uso, particularmente para aplicaciones
de cliente-servidor de web.

descarga (2)
1991 Aparece Python

Desarrollado por Guido van Rossum, es un
lenguaje de programación de alto nivel, posee
una sintaxis amplia así como favorece el código
legible.Soporta programación imperativa, orientada
a objetos, multiplataforma, manejo de excepciones y
es un lenguaje interpretado.Es administrado por la
Python Software Foundation. Posee una licencia de código
abierto, denominada Python Software Foundation License

1994 Se inventa PhP

Acrónimo de «HyperText Processor», es un lenguaje de
programación de script desarrollado por Rasmus Lerdof.
Se utiliza para la programación de páginas dinámicas en
servidores y el desarrollo de aplicaciones en diferentes
sistemas operativos.Fue uno de los primeros lenguajes de
programación del lado del servidor que se podían incorporar
directamente en el documento HTML en lugar de llamar a un archivo
externo que procese los datos. El código es interpretado por un
servidor web con un módulo de procesador de PHP que genera la página Web resultante.

Deja un comentario